- •1.Дайте определение понятию информационная система. Объясните концепцию информационной системы. Приведите типологию информационных систем.
- •2.Укажите особенности информационно-поисковых, информационно-справочных, информационно-управляющих и экспертных систем. Кратко опишите каждую из перечисленных информационных систем.
- •3.Дайте определение понятиям база данных и система управления базами данных. Объясните необходимость планирования базы данных (бд). Опишите жизненный цикл бд.
- •4.Дайте понятие модели представления данных. Перечислите модели представления данных. Опишите реляционную модель данных.
- •5.Дайте понятие проектирование реляционной базы данных. Дайте определение понятиям сущность, атрибут и отношение. Опишите процесс преобразования концептуальной модели в реляционную.
- •6.Сравните существующие системы управления базами данных. Перечислите основные характеристики реляционной системы управления базами данных (субд).
- •8.Опишите аппарат индексирования реляционной субд. Укажите назначения и основные возможности при использовании индексированных таблиц.
- •19.Дайте понятие реляционной алгебры. Перечислите операции реляционной алгебры. Опишите теоретико-множественные операции реляционной алгебры.
- •20.Дайте понятие реляционной алгебры. Перечислите операции реляционной алгебры. Опишите специальные операции реляционной алгебры.
- •12.Опишите структуру команды языка запросов sql. Приведите пример создания запроса.
- •25.Перечислите принципы визуального объектно-ориентированного программирования (ооп). Опишите технологию и основные объекты программирования. Укажите область применения визуального ооп.
- •24.Дайте представление об использовании ole – технологии в проектировании бд. Охарактеризуйте процессы внедрения и связывания объектов.
- •26.Дайте понятие запроса. Опишите процесс формирования и создания визуального запроса. Перечислите формы отображения визуального запроса.
- •27.Дайте понятие отчета. Перечислите типы отчетов. Опишите процесс создания отчета.
- •28.Дайте понятие клиент-серверной архитектуры. Опишите многопользовательскую работу с бд в локальной сети.
- •29.Дайте понятие клиент-серверной архитектуры. Опишите работу с бд в глобальной сети.
- •17.Перечислите группы функций субд Access. Опишите функции и команды управления базой данных.
- •1.Изложите материал по истории развития субд. Опишите субд FoxPro.
- •3,Дайте общую характеристику субд FoxPro ( ее преимущества, типы данных и файлов, используемых в субд) и опишите процесс настройки системы.
- •4,Опишите проект приложения как обязательный компонент при работе с базами данных в FoxPro. Опишите процесс создания баз данных и укажите основные действия при создании бд.
- •5,Опишите процесс создания таблиц в FoxPro и укажите последовательность действий. Опишите процесс модификации таблиц в FoxPro и укажите последовательность действий
- •6,Изложите материал по индексам в субд FoxPro. Опишите процесс создания первичного ключа. Опишите процесс создания составного индекса.
- •7,Изложите материал по отношениям между таблицами в субд FoxPro. Опишите процесс создания отношений между таблицами.
- •9,Опишите структуру пользовательской программы, написанной на языке FoxPro. Опишите процесс создания, запуска и модификации программы.
- •10,Изложите материал по использованию переменных в языке FoxPro. Укажите виды переменных, команды объявления, инициализации и отображения переменных.
- •11,Изложите материал по использованию массивов в языке FoxPro. Опишите основные манипуляции с массивами. Изложите материал по созданию и использованию пользовательских процедур и функций.
- •12,Изложите материал по командам структурного программирования в языке FoxPro. Опишите обработку особых ситуаций .
- •13,Изложите материал по установке программной среды в языке FoxPro. Опишите ввод и вывод информации.
- •15,Изложите материал по работе с окнами в FoxPro. Опишите основные команды по работе с окнами и их параметры.
- •16,Изложите материал по визуальному программированию на языке FoxPro.
- •18.Опишите основные компоненты Visual FoxPro 9. Опишите экран Visual FoxPro.
- •19.Опишите проектирование структуры базы данных. Дайте понятие основным формам нормализации.
- •20.Опишите процесс создания форм с помощью конструктора в FoxPro. Опишите процесс создания форм с помощью мастера в FoxPro.
- •21.Опишите визуальные объекты, которые можно расположить на форме. Укажите их основные свойства и методы .
- •22.Опишите создание однотабличных запросов к бд в Visual FoxPro 9.
- •23.Опишите создание многотабличных запросов к бд в Visual FoxPro 9.
- •24.Опишите процесс создания вычисляемых полей и итоговых значений при разработке запросов в Visual FoxPro 9. Опишите процесс создания перекрестных таблиц и диаграмм при разработке запросов.
- •25.Изложите материал по отчетам в Visual FoxPro 9.
21.Опишите визуальные объекты, которые можно расположить на форме. Укажите их основные свойства и методы .
Текстовая информация
Размещение текста (заголовков, надписей, поясняющей информации) осуществляется с помощью кнопки Label .
Основные свойства Label:
BackStyle – стиль фона, если необходимо, чтобы фон был прозрачным, установить данное свойство Transparent;
Caption– задает текс метки;
FontName– задает наименование шрифта;
FontSize – задает размер шрифта;
ForeColor – задает цвет надписи;
AutoSize – корректирует размер объекта, чтобы в нем помещалась вся надпись. Установить свойство True.
Поле ввода
Для отображения информации из таблиц в форме предназначен элемент управления TextBox .
Основные свойства:
ControlSource – размещено на вкладке Data. Предназначено для связывания созданного поля с полем таблицы. Из раскрывающегося списка выбрать необходимое поле таблицы.
Alignment – задает вариант выравнивания информации в поле: по центру, по левому или правому краям.
BorderStyle – задает стиль рамки.
BorderColor – задает цвет рамки.
DisabledBackColor – задает цвет фона неактивного окна.
Comment – задает краткое описание назначения размещенного объекта.
FontName – задает наименование шрифта.
FontSize – задает размер шрифта.
ForeColor – задает цвет надписи.
Format – значения данного свойства используются для отображения полей ввода в заданном формате. Допустимые форматы приведены в приложении (Г).
InputMask – позволяет задать шаблон. Символы, которые могут использоваться в шаблоне приведены в приложении (Д).
ReadOnly – значение True для данного поля означает, что вся информация поля ввода доступна только для чтения.
SpecialEffect – задает стиль отображения поля из трех предложенных вариантов: обычный, с эффектом объемности или принимающий объемный вид при перемещении курсора мыши над ним.
StatusBarText – задает поясняющую надпись, выводимую в строку состояния, при установке на поле курсора мыши.
ToolTipText – задает текст подсказки.
ShowTips – значение True данного свойства указывает на то, что будут отображаться подсказки.
Value – при добавлении новой записи в поле по умолчанию можно вводить наиболее часто встречающиеся значения.
Поле редактирования
Поле редактирования EditBox удобны для редактирования символьных полей большого размера и MEMO-полей.
Основные свойства поля редактирования:
Основные свойства аналогичны свойствам поля ввода. При использовании поля данного типа для просмотра и редактирования полей большого размера, в его правой части можно расположить полосу прокрутки. Для этого в свойстве ScrollBars задать значение Vertical или None (полоса прокрутки отображаться не будет).
Кнопки управления
Для размещения кнопок управления в форме можно использовать две кнопки панелеи инструментов CommandButton и CommandGroup .
22.Опишите создание однотабличных запросов к бд в Visual FoxPro 9.
Для быстрого поиска информации в БД и получения ответов на различные вопросы предназначены запросы.
Создание запросов
На вкладке Data конструктора проекта выбрать группу Queries.
Нажать кнопку New.
В открывшемся диалоговом окне NewQuery нажать кнопку NewQuery.
В открывшемся диалоговом окне выбрать таблицы, данные из которых необходимо использовать в запросе и с помощью кнопки Add перенести их в окно конструктора запросов.
Завершив выбор таблиц, нажать кнопку Close.
На экране появится окно конструктора запросов, где формируются условия запроса.
Запуск запроса на выполнение
Основные способы просмотра результатов выполнения запроса:
Нажать кнопку на стандартной панели инструментов;
Выбрать команду контекстного меню RunQuery;
Выполнить команду меню QueryRunQuery.